打造美观实用的手机端CSS导航菜单

需积分: 1 0 下载量 12 浏览量 更新于2024-10-24 收藏 3KB RAR 举报
资源摘要信息: "漂亮的css手机端导航菜单" 是一份专注于移动设备用户体验的前端设计资源。该资源着重于通过CSS样式来实现一个在手机端表现优异的导航菜单,使得移动用户的交互体验更加流畅和美观。导航菜单是网站或应用程序中不可或缺的一部分,特别是在移动互联网领域,它关系到用户能否快速找到所需信息,因此其设计至关重要。 文件名称列表中的 "style.css" 文件意味着包含了导航菜单的样式定义。通过CSS文件,开发者可以设置导航菜单的字体、颜色、大小、间距、动画效果以及响应式布局等属性,以适应不同屏幕尺寸的移动设备。这包括但不限于按钮的样式、菜单的展开和收起动画、触摸滑动效果等。CSS的使用使得设计师可以不受限制地表达创意,同时也保持了代码的可维护性和可扩展性。 而 "index.html" 文件则代表了导航菜单的HTML结构。HTML文件包含了必要的导航链接和可能的子菜单项,是构成导航菜单内容的基础。HTML结构需要清晰且语义化,以便搜索引擎优化(SEO)和辅助技术(如屏幕阅读器)能够正确解析导航菜单的层级和功能。此外,该文件还需要与CSS文件协同工作,以展现设计者构思的视觉效果。 这份资源的描述虽然简单,但从中可以推断出以下知识点: 1. 响应式设计:在移动设备上导航菜单需要能够适应不同分辨率和屏幕尺寸。这通常涉及到媒体查询(media queries)的使用,确保在不同设备上都能提供良好的用户体验。 2. 用户交互:为了使导航菜单更加友好,设计师会利用CSS来添加触摸滑动效果,如滑入滑出动画、按压效果等。这些交互效果的实现需要对CSS3的过渡(transitions)、变换(transforms)、动画(animations)等属性有所掌握。 3. 布局技巧:在手机端,空间往往受限,所以设计师需要利用灵活的布局方法来确保导航菜单的可用性。例如,使用弹性盒子(flexbox)或网格(grid)布局系统,可以更容易地创建复杂的布局结构,并且在不同屏幕尺寸上保持一致性。 4. 性能优化:移动设备的性能通常不如桌面设备,因此压缩CSS文件、减少外部资源请求、合理使用CSS选择器等优化措施,对于提升加载速度和改善用户交互体验至关重要。 5. 兼容性处理:在编写移动端的CSS代码时,考虑到不同浏览器和操作系统的兼容性是非常重要的。这可能涉及使用前缀来支持旧版本浏览器,或者使用CSS的兼容性工具如Autoprefixer。 6. 可访问性:设计一个对所有用户都友好的导航菜单,意味着需要考虑可访问性。这包括确保足够的颜色对比度、键盘可导航以及屏幕阅读器的友好性。 结合以上知识点,该资源为开发者和设计师提供了一套设计和实现漂亮手机端导航菜单的解决方案。通过使用CSS的高级特性,结合HTML的有效结构,可以构建一个既美观又实用的导航菜单,提升移动用户的浏览体验。